3p15, jan 22, the normal curve (5) and measures of central tendency and dispersion (6) Three measures of central tendency: mode: the most common score, median: the middle score, mean: the average score. The mode: the most common or frequent score, not an arithmetic measure, can be used with variables at all levels of measurement, most often used with nominal level variables. How to find the mode graphically: the biggest slice of the pie is the mode. Finding the median (for interval/ratio data: arrange the cases from high to low (or low to high). Locate the middle case: if n is odd, the median is the value for the middle case, if n is even, the median is the average of the scores of the two middle cases.
